Definition of Escape Key

The Escape Key, often labeled as “Esc,” is a keyboard key commonly found in the upper-left corner of a computer keyboard. It is utilized to interrupt or cancel a running process or operation within a program or application. The Escape Key also closes dialog boxes, windows, and menus, allowing users to revert to the previous state or action.

Explanation

The escape key, often abbreviated as “Esc,” serves as an essential tool in computer operations, allowing users to quickly halt or interrupt ongoing processes or actions. As an intuitive and ergonomic means of ceasing the current activity, the escape key plays a crucial role in enhancing user experience and ensures a more efficient workflow.

The key, typically found in the top left corner of a keyboard, is much easier to access compared to a combination of keys in various scenarios. Whether it’s used to exit a full-screen application, terminate a slow loading web page, or cancel a partially entered command, the escape key offers immense practical value and comes in handy during everyday tasks.

One of the main purposes of the escape key is to provide users with a convenient way to navigate through software, games, and other interactive applications. For example, in video games, the escape key often brings up a pause menu, allowing players to access various options like settings, controls, or exit the game altogether.

In graphics or text editing software, the escape key can be used to deselect a selected object or cancel an ongoing transformation action. Overall, the escape key serves as a versatile and time-saving tool that streamlines computer interactions and ensures user control over processes and events.

Escape Key FAQ

What is the Escape key?

The Escape key, also known as the ‘Esc’ key, is a keyboard button that allows users to stop or cancel a function or operation being performed. Its symbol usually looks like a diagonal arrow pointing to the left and up.

What is the main purpose of the Escape key?

The main purpose of the Escape key is to provide users with an option to abort or stop a process, exit a program, or close a window. It is especially useful in situations where a user needs to quickly stop or cancel an action that is currently being performed.

What is the position of the Escape key?

The Escape key is typically located at the top-left corner of a keyboard, just above the ‘F1’ key and the ‘Tab’ key.

How do I use the Escape key in different software applications?

The use of the Escape key varies depending on the software application in use. In general, it is used to stop, cancel, or exit a function or operation. In some applications, pressing the Escape key might close a window, deselect options, or exit a full-screen mode. To understand its specific function in a particular software application, consult the user manual or help documentation of that application.

Can I remap my Escape key to perform other actions?

Yes, it is possible to remap your Escape key to perform different actions using third-party key remapping software. However, be cautious while remapping important keys like the Escape key, as doing so can cause confusion or result in unexpected behavior when working with different applications.
